    Wisconsin football got a taste of harsh reality on Saturday when the Badgers got demolished by the Alabama Crimson Tide at home. The 42-10 loss at the hands of the SEC powerhouse was the first defeat of the 2024 college football season for the Badgers, who simply got overpowered in virtually every aspect of the contest.

    After the tough loss in Madison by the Badgers, Wisconsin football cornerback Ricardo Hallman did not try to hide his thoughts about where his team stands as opposed to Alabama.

    Via Jesse Temple of The Athletic:

    โ€œItโ€™s easy for me to say, โ€˜Oh, no, you canโ€™t judge us off of that,โ€™โ€ Wisconsin cornerback Ricardo Hallman said. โ€œBut at the same time, you guys saw that. Alabama is one of the juggernauts in college football. Thatโ€™s where we want to be as a team, and we got completely obliterated today, and that was terrible. So itโ€™s easy for me to say, โ€˜Oh, you canโ€™t judge us.โ€™ But I donโ€™t know really what to say to that. This was an early season test we failed.โ€

    The Badgers came up with just 290 total yards versus Alabama, which racked up 407 yards of its own. Crimson Tide quarterback Jalen Milroe passed for 196 yards and three touchdowns on 12/17 completions while also rushing for two scores and 75 yards on 14 carries. What made the day worse for Wisconsin was the injury suffered by starting quarterback Tyler Van Dyke early in the contest. Wisconsin went just 3/14 on first downs and turned the ball over twice.

    It is not about to get much easier for Wisconsin, as the Badgers will be playing their first road game of the season against a ranked team in the form of the USC Trojans on September 28.ย
